14CE1-1 Honeywell Limit Switch Overview
The 14CE1-1 Honeywell limit switch is part of Honeywell’s MICRO SWITCH 14CE Series, a compact enclosed limit switch range built for harsh industrial conditions. In the official series documentation, the 14CE platform is positioned as a rugged miniature precision switch family with strong environmental sealing, multiple actuator options, and long mechanical life.
What Is the 14CE1-1 Honeywell Limit Switch?
The Honeywell 14CE1-1 limit switch is the top pin plunger version within the 14CE Series. The series uses SPDT snap-action contacts in Form C configuration and is designed for applications where precise actuation and dependable environmental resistance are both important. Its compact enclosed design makes it useful in machinery where space is limited but reliability still has to remain high.
One of the strongest technical advantages of the 14CE1-1 Honeywell industrial switch family is sealing. Honeywell states that the 14CE Series offers protection meeting IP65, IP66, IP67, and IP68, with several NEMA ratings also supported. That makes the series relevant in environments exposed to water, dust, oil, and demanding factory-floor conditions.
Key Technical Characteristics
The 14CE1-1 Honeywell limit switch belongs to a series with an operating temperature range of 0 °C to 70 °C, with optional low-temperature variants available down to -40 °C. Honeywell also specifies mechanical life up to 10 million cycles, depending on actuator style, which is an important advantage for repetitive industrial motion control.
The series supports SPDT snap-action contacts, rated insulation voltage of 250 V, and thermal current options of 1 A, 3 A, or 5 A depending on model configuration. Honeywell also notes features such as pre-leaded cable or connector options, wide actuator variety, and gang-mounting capability for multi-plunger arrangements. These design choices make the Honeywell 14CE1-1 industrial limit switch a practical option for machine tools, packaging equipment, robotics, material handling systems, and agricultural machinery.
Why the 14CE1-1 Honeywell Limit Switch Stands Out
What makes the 14CE1-1 Honeywell limit switch especially relevant is the balance between compact size and industrial durability. The 14CE Series uses diaphragm sealing and encapsulated terminations for improved protection in harsh environments. For engineers, that means a smaller switch footprint without giving up robust field performance.
The top pin plunger format also makes the Honeywell 14CE1-1 limit switch suitable for controlled linear actuation points where consistent triggering matters. In real machine design, that combination of sealing, repeatability, and form factor can simplify placement and support long-term service reliability.
